The tripartite design of psychological well-being views psychological well-being as encompassing 3 components of psychological wellness, social well-being, and mental well-being. Emotional well-being is specified as having high levels of favorable emotions, whereas social and psychological well-being are specified as the presence of mental and social skills and capabilities that contribute to optimal working in daily life. The design has actually gotten empirical support throughout cultures. The Mental Health Continuum-Short Type (MHC-SF) is the most commonly utilized scale to measure the tripartite design of mental wellness.

Sueki, (2013) brought out a study titled "The impact of suicide-related internet usage on users' psychological health: A longitudinal Study". This study investigated the results of suicide-related web usage on user's self-destructive ideas, predisposition to depression and anxiety, and solitude. The study included 850 internet users; the data was acquired by performing a survey amongst the participants. This study discovered that searching websites associated with suicide, and techniques utilized to commit suicide, harmed self-destructive thoughts and increased anxiety and stress and anxiety propensities.
